Another fascinating application of twin DNA testing is in studying the effects of nature versus nurture on development By analyzing the genetic material of twins raised in different environments, researchers can gain insights into how genes and environmental factors interact to shape human traits and behaviors This type of research can help us better understand complex traits such as intelligence, personality, and susceptibility to various diseases
